Kim Faulkner Riley, Ithaca College Alumna, Class of ’99 posted:
Here is the e-mail I sent to the mascot committee and the president an his cabinet.
Hello Everyone,
I have waited to write my own e-mail after reading several that other alumni have sent. Since I felt the same as many others do about the Mascot search, I didn’t want to send another e-mail with the same points. However, I want to make it clear that I do not support a new Mascot. I do feel strongly that this is just one step toward “doing away with” the Bomber name altogether and the tradition that the Bomber name represents.
Here is my question: We have a Facebook page with over 2000 members who DO NOT support a new Mascot. The Ithacan has written several stories and editorials about how much staff, students, coaches, and especially alumni are not in favor of a new mascot. Even your head football coach is publicly against a new mascot. The Syracuse newspaper has written an article about the subject. And worst of all, Cortland fans has posted on their websites how sorry they feel for us. Even Cortland knows this idea is absurd. So, where are all these students who want this? Where is the “outcry” from students who desperately want this change? Where is the facebook page “We want the squirrel” or “Bring on the lake beast?” Where are the the student letters to the Ithacan asking for this change? Where are they? In several public statements from the president and the mascot committee it has been mentioned that this is student driven. Really? WHERE ARE THEY? The students who have voiced their opinions in the Ithacan and elsewhere are indifferent at best. Most who have commented are against it.
Therefore, before the committee goes any further, I ask you all why? Why make this change when so many are indifferent at best, or altogether against it? I look forward to hearing from you either individually or as a group. Thank you for your time.
